Sarah Ferguson is celebrating the International Women’s Day.

On Saturday, March 8, the Duchess of York shared a four-slide post on her Instagram as she celebrated the “strength, resilience, and achievements” of women all around the world.

The carousel featured several snaps of the Duchess with some of the women she met during her life.

“On #InternationalWomensDay, we celebrate the strength, resilience, and achievements of women everywhere. From those who have shaped history to the countless unsung heroes making a difference every day, their impact is truly remarkable,” Sarah captioned.

She then expressed pride in being a mother and grandmother, reflecting, “As a mother to two incredible daughters and a grandmother to two wonderful girls, I feel so fortunate to be surrounded by strong, compassionate, and inspiring women.”

The mother-of-two also shared that having encountered hundreds of women throughout her life, she was constantly reminded of the power of kindness, courage, and determination.

“Women supporting women is one of the greatest forces for change. So today, and every day, let’s continue to lift each other up and celebrate the women who inspire us. #IWD,” Prince Andrew’s ex-wife concluded.
